On Saturday we did a circular route from Predmeja over Little Golak and further to Anton Bavčar hut on Čaven. It was quite cold, on the Golaks +1 degree but foggy and it was quite windy. Of course we warmed up properly with schnapps . The path section from the hut below Golak to Čaven is very nice.

Predmeja - Mali Golak 1 h, Mali Golak - hut below Mali Golak - Anton Bavčar hut on Čaven 1.5 h,.... We went quite fast because darkness was chasing us.

With yesterday's weather on the edge (of rain) and wind, pleasant circular path Predmeja (main intersection) - sports park Tiha dolina - Mali Golak - Iztok's hut below Golaki - Anton Bavčar hut on Čaven - Predmeja. The path is excellently marked in some places, sufficiently good elsewhere, if you combine some descriptions from hribi.net. Pleasantly spent 5h, with breaks. Otherwise marked as: - Predmeja - sports park 20 min - sports park - Mali Golak 2h - Mali Golak - hut below Golaki 30 min - Hut below Golaki - hut on Čaven 2h30 - Hut on Čaven - Predmeja 50 min Recommend as spring preparation for high mountains (fitness) as it accumulates enviable 1050 v.m. and over 20 (walked) km.

We walked the path today in the opposite direction. We started before Predmeja and via the Srednječavenska path reached the hut on Čavn. We continued over Veliki Modrasovec, from there to the Hut below Golaki and on to Mali Golak. We descended to Predmeja past the E. Čibej hut in Tiha dolina and a few more kilometers on the road to the car. We took less than 5 hours. Dry to Čavn, further on still quite some snow - today it was softened, crampons not needed.
